Shopping in Notting Hill, Victoria is convenient with nearby retail options such as Brandon Park Shopping Centre located within a short driving distance, offering a variety of shops, cafes, and supermarkets to cater to residents' daily needs.
The suburb boasts access to reputable primary and secondary schools, including Monash University, known for its high academic standards and diverse educational programs, providing families with quality education options for their children.
Notting Hill is well-connected to the CBD in Victoria via public transportation, with the nearest train station being Clayton Station, providing easy access to Melbourne's CBD. Additionally, there are bus routes along Ferntree Gully Road and Blackburn Road, offering alternative commuting options.
Surrounding greenery in Notting Hill includes the picturesque Bushy Park Wetlands, providing residents with a tranquil escape into nature for leisurely walks, birdwatching, and enjoying the peaceful surroundings. The nearby Jells Park also offers expansive green spaces, walking trails, and picnic areas for outdoor activities.

As of March 2026, the Notting Hill property market presents a stable investment landscape. Over the last 12 months, houses have seen an annual growth rate of -4.66% and units have grown by 19%. These figures reflect the evolving demand within Monash, offering potential for long-term value preservation.
Based on the latest market snapshot, median property prices in Notting Hill range from $1,125,000 for houses to $415,000 for units. These values are calculated based on recent transaction data and current buyer activity across the Monash region.
For investors targeting cash flow, houses rent for $645 /pw with a 2.98% yield, while units rent for $560 /pw with a 7.02% yield. This rental performance is a key indicator of strong tenant demand within the Notting Hill area.
